Specialist note
Oliver Calley Esq. of Burderop (b. 1672), was the grandson of William Calley Esq. (1600-1660) who purchased Burderop Park from the Stephen family during the reign of Elizabeth I. William Calley was a steadfast opponent of the royal cause during the Civil War and his signature is attached to the death warrant of Charles I. Calley was forced to forfeit his lands, which were later restored to the family.
